4-bed 3-bath family layout | three distinct living zones | premium finishes and butler’s pantry | quiet owner-occupied street | main bedroom with balcony The property is a 4-bedroom, 3-bathroom house with three distinct living zones (front study/lounge, upstairs rumpus, rear open-plan living/dining), a genuinely flexible family floorplan. High-spec finishes including spotted gum floors, high ceilings, stone benchtops, double glazing, and a butler’s pantry with second cooktop sit above typical suburban stock. Owner-occupier families are served best, especially those wanting a low-maintenance house with premium inclusions and multiple spaces for work, play, and entertaining. The quiet street and owner-occupier presence reinforce appeal to buyers seeking a settled neighbourhood. The price positioning may reflect the premium fit-out and finishes more than land content, which may be weighed against older suburban stock. Three parking spaces with internal garage entry may be valued highly by families, though the rear yard is private but compact. Double glazing and roller shutters may improve energy performance, while evaporative cooling might struggle on extreme heat days. Market Insight

Coburg North is a northern Melbourne suburb positioned around transport access. Demand comes mainly from families; sales data show 3-4 bedroom houses dominating and clearance rates are high: 70.6% for houses (Woodards) and 82.8% (REIV). House medians range $965k-$1.05m, with annual growth -0.94% to +2.6%; REIV shows $1.2m and +4.5% quarterly. Units lag: medians $570k-$725k, growth -11.2% to +6.7%. Houses clear in 41-49 days; units sit 111 days. Rental yields favour units (4.35% vs 3.27% houses); weekly rents are $650-$680 for houses and $595-$600 for units. Future demand rests on transport links and family-oriented stock, but rate sensitivity and a 22.2% fall in house sales volumes are constraints.
